Web开发实战:从需求到部署的高效路径

Web开发是一个从概念到实际应用的过程,涉及多个阶段的协作与技术整合。明确需求是整个项目的基础,开发者需要与客户或产品经理深入沟通,确保对功能、界面和性能有清晰的理解。

在设计阶段,可以采用原型工具快速构建界面模型,帮助团队成员和利益相关者直观地看到产品的初步形态。同时,选择合适的技术栈也是关键,前端可考虑React或Vue,后端则可根据项目规模选择Node.js、Django或Spring Boot等框架。

AI绘图结果,仅供参考

开发过程中,遵循模块化和组件化的思路有助于提高代码的可维护性。使用版本控制工具如Git进行代码管理,并通过持续集成(CI)确保代码质量。测试环节不可忽视,包括单元测试、集成测试以及用户验收测试,以减少上线后的风险。

部署阶段需要考虑服务器环境、数据库配置以及安全性问题。使用Docker容器化部署可以提升应用的一致性和可移植性,而云服务如AWS或阿里云则提供了灵活的资源扩展能力。同时,监控工具如Prometheus和日志分析系统能帮助及时发现并解决问题。

最终,通过不断迭代优化产品,根据用户反馈调整功能和体验,才能实现一个稳定、高效且符合用户需求的Web应用。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复